As a Design Surveyor, your role will be to provide an expert home measure service to our customers. You'll visit the customer in their home, complete a survey on their kitchen and record all details, before heading back to the showroom to transfer the measurements onto our kitchen planner and liaising with the Kitchen Designer. We'll supply all of the equipment you'll need to conduct your role, including a vehicle, laptop, phone and laser measure.
To be successful in this role, you'll need to pay strong attention to detail to ensure that all designs are accurate and have knowledge and understanding of fitting legal requirements. Ideally, you'll have previous experience of conducting home measures. A driving licence is essential.

Here are more details about what our Design Surveyors do at Wren:
Critical purpose of role:
To provide an expert home measure and liaise with fitters
Adhere to all legal requirements and compliance processes
Main responsibilities:
To visit customers' homes and provide a professional home measure service
Complete home survey accurately and record all details on home measure pad
Transfer measurements to planner and upload home measure sheet into system
Liaise with Design Consultant to ensure they are aware of any particular requirements e.g. dog lives in kitchen etc.
Liaise with Wren or customer fitter for signer approval of plan
Feedback to design consultant of any amendments required
